F.P. Journe. A Fine Limited Edition Platinum Automatic Wristwatch with Power Reserve, Date, Month and Zodiac
Signed F.P. Journe, Invenit Et Fecit, Octa Zodiaque Model, No. 137/150-Z, Circa 2004
Movement: Automatic, Cal. 1300, 22k gold rotor
Dial: 18k gold, grey, Arabic numerals, subsidiary seconds, date, power reserve and zodiac
Case: Platinum, sapphire crystal display back secured by six screws, 40mm diam.
Buckle: F.P. Journe platinum buckle
Accompanied by: F.P. Journe Certificate/Warranty dated August, 2008, product literature, an F.P. Journe presentation box,an F.P. Journe polishing cloth and outer packaging

Lot Essay

F.P Journe produced the Octa Zodiaque in a limited edition of 150 pieces between 2003 and 2005.

With the dial that transitions from simplicity in the center to complication around the edges, Journe alluded to the position of the stars in the sky. The outer ring rotates to display the current zodiac sign at the 12 o'clock position. The silver and slate grey dial is reminiscent of the other models of the Octa collection; however, the Zodiaque is only the second watch from F.P. Journe that features central hour and minute hands.
